I have a recent 21.5inch with i5 2.5 processor (MC309).
I installed XP successfully under bootcamp but when I entered the OS10 disc for the XP drivers I got the message not a W7 installation. I downloaded drivers in the bootcamp option and burnt to a CD but the result was the same not a W7 installation.
What drivers, and where, do I download for XP to include the graphics Radeon 6750?

Newer systems don't have XP drivers, only Windows 7. If you want to use XP with this system you'll need to use something like VMWare Fusion, is my understanding, as Bootcamp won't natively supply XP drivers.

I manged to download a copy of bootcamp 3 and with additional drivers from Broadcom and Atheros sites have XP working OK.
Still looking for XP drivers for the Radeon HD6750M graphics . The generic drivers work but quality is not that good.
